An exceptional Sèvres soft-porcelain hinged ewer and basin, 1766, H 16,5 - W 26 cm

Decorated with hand-painted flowers and heightened with gilt, the 'Oeil de Perdrix' border is blue and pink. The bottom of the ewer and of the basin have a Sèvres mark of the interlaced double L, the date letter 'N', referring to 1766, and the symbol for the painter Guillaume Noël. The silver hinge of the ewer with an 18thC Parisian hallmark.

  • Condition: Some retouches to the hand-painted decoration.
